Burnie T Poland 1919 - 1997

Burnie T Poland of Crittenden, Grant County, KY was born on July 20, 1919, and died at age 77 years old on June 11, 1997.

In 1945, at the age of 26 years old, Burnie was alive when on August 15th, Imperial Japan announced its surrender. On September 2nd, a formal agreement of surrender was signed. Japan and nine other states signed the Japanese Instrument of Surrender in Tokyo Bay, calling for the return of all Allied prisoners of war and subordinating the authority of the emperor and the Japanese government to the Supreme Commander for the Allied Powers. VJ (Victory in Japan) Day was celebrated in the United States on August 14th and 15th. World War II was over.
